What Features Should You Consider When Selecting the Best Winch for a Quad?

When selecting the best winch for a quad, there are several key features to consider that will enhance performance and reliability.

  • Weight Capacity: The winch should be able to handle loads that exceed the weight of your quad and any additional cargo. A winch with a weight capacity of at least 1.5 times the weight of your quad is recommended to ensure safe operation.
  • Motor Power: The power of the winch motor directly affects its pulling speed and efficiency. Electric winches typically range from 2,500 to 5,500 pounds in pulling power; thus, choosing a motor that aligns with your intended usage is essential for optimal performance.
  • Line Length and Material: The length and type of winch line can impact your winching capability. A synthetic rope is lighter and safer as it doesn’t store energy like steel cables, while heavier-duty applications may benefit from steel cables for their durability.
  • Gear Ratio: The gear ratio determines how fast the winch can pull a load. A higher gear ratio offers faster line speeds, making it suitable for lighter loads, while a lower gear ratio provides more power for heavy loads, which is ideal for tough terrain.
  • Remote Control Options: Having remote control capabilities can greatly enhance safety and convenience. Look for winches that offer wireless remote options, allowing you to operate the winch from a safe distance while positioning your quad effectively.
  • Mounting Hardware: Ensure that the winch comes with the appropriate mounting hardware or that it is compatible with your quad’s frame. Proper installation is crucial for safety and can affect the winch’s performance during use.
  • Weather Resistance: Since quads are often used in harsh outdoor conditions, choosing a winch that features weatherproofing or corrosion-resistant materials will help prolong its lifespan and maintain functionality.
  • Brand Reputation and Warranty: Opt for winches from reputable brands known for quality and reliability. A good warranty can also provide peace of mind, indicating the manufacturer’s confidence in their product.

How Does the Type of Cable Material Affect Winch Longevity and Durability?

The type of cable material used in a winch significantly impacts its longevity and durability. The two primary materials for winch cables are steel and synthetic rope, each with its distinct characteristics.

Steel Cables:
Durability: Steel cables are known for their high tensile strength and resistance to abrasion, making them suitable for heavy-duty applications. They can withstand harsh elements and are less likely to fray over time.
Weight and Handling: However, they are considerably heavier, which can affect handling and storage. Steel cables can be cumbersome and require gloves for safe handling due to sharp edges.
Corrosion Resistance: Steel cables may need protective coatings to prevent rust, especially when exposed to moisture or saltwater environments.

Synthetic Ropes:
Weight: Lighter than steel, synthetic ropes make winching easier and can be more user-friendly for smaller quads.
Safety: They don’t store energy like steel cables, reducing the risk of backlash if they snap, making them safer to handle.
UV Resistance: Many synthetic materials are UV resistant, enhancing their longevity when exposed to sunlight. However, they can be susceptible to cuts and abrasions, so careful handling is essential.

Selecting the right cable type depends on usage, environmental conditions, and personal preference, which will ultimately influence the winch’s performance and lifespan.

What Types of Winches Are Most Suitable for Quads?

The best winches for quads are typically categorized based on their power source, capacity, and features. Here are the most suitable types:

  • Electric Winches: Electric winches are popular for their ease of use and installation. They are powered by the quad’s battery, providing instant power and often featuring remote controls for convenience.
  • Hydraulic Winches: Hydraulic winches are known for their high pulling capacity and durability, making them ideal for heavy-duty applications. They use hydraulic fluid pressure, which allows for smoother operation and can be more efficient in demanding conditions.
  • Portable Winches: Designed for versatility, portable winches can be easily mounted on different vehicles or moved to various locations. They are often lightweight, allowing for easy transport, which makes them a great option for those who need a winch for various tasks.
  • Capstan Winches: Capstan winches are well-suited for pulling heavy loads over long distances. Unlike traditional winches that rely on a drum to store the rope, capstan winches allow for continuous rope feeding, making them ideal for scenarios where a long pull is required.
  • Synthetic Rope Winches: Winches using synthetic rope are becoming increasingly popular due to their lightweight nature and safety benefits. They are easier to handle compared to steel cables and reduce the risk of recoil if the line snaps, making them a safer choice for quad enthusiasts.

What Are the Key Considerations for Installing a Winch on Your Quad?

When installing a winch on your quad, several key considerations come into play to ensure optimal performance and safety.

  • Winch Capacity: It’s crucial to select a winch with a capacity that exceeds the weight of your quad and any potential loads you plan to pull. A winch rated for at least 1.5 times the weight of your quad will provide a safety margin and ensure reliable operation under heavy loads.
  • Mounting Location: The location where the winch is mounted can greatly affect its performance and accessibility. Ideally, it should be positioned to provide a clear line of pull and avoid obstructions, while also being easily reachable for operation and maintenance.
  • Power Source: Winches can be powered by either a direct electrical connection or a battery, so it’s important to ensure your quad’s electrical system can support the winch’s power requirements. Consider the gauge of wiring and the battery capacity to prevent voltage drops during heavy pulls, which can lead to winch failure.
  • Type of Rope: The choice between synthetic rope and steel cable will influence the winch’s performance and safety. Synthetic ropes are lighter, easier to handle, and safer since they don’t snap back if they break, while steel cables are more durable and resistant to abrasion but can be heavier and more dangerous if mishandled.
  • Control Options: Winches come with various control options such as handheld remotes, wireless controls, or in-cab switches. Selecting the right control method is essential for convenience and safety, allowing you to operate the winch from a safe distance or while seated on the quad.
  • Installation and Maintenance: Proper installation is vital for the winch’s longevity and functionality, so following manufacturer guidelines is essential. Regular maintenance, including checking connections, lubricating parts, and inspecting the rope or cable for wear, will help ensure reliable operation over time.

How Can Proper Installation Ensure Safe and Effective Winch Operation?

Proper installation is crucial for ensuring safe and effective winch operation, especially when selecting the best winch for a quad.

  • Correct Mounting Location: The winch should be mounted on a stable platform that can support its weight and withstand the forces exerted during operation. An inappropriate mounting location may lead to instability and increase the risk of accidents while winching.
  • Wiring and Electrical Connections: Proper wiring is essential for the winch to operate effectively; this includes securing connections and using the correct gauge of wire. Poor electrical connections can lead to overheating, reduced performance, or even failure of the winch during critical moments.
  • Fairlead Alignment: The fairlead must be properly aligned with the winch to ensure the cable feeds smoothly without causing wear or tangling. A misaligned fairlead can lead to cable damage and failure, potentially causing injury or accidents.
  • Weight Distribution: It is important to ensure that the quad’s weight distribution is balanced when the winch is in use. Uneven weight can cause the quad to tip over or become unstable, leading to potential hazards while operating the winch.
  • Safety Features Installation: Incorporating safety features like circuit breakers or remote controls can enhance the safety of winch operation. These features help prevent electrical overloads and allow for safe operation from a distance, reducing the risk of injury.

What Maintenance Practices Extend the Lifespan of Your Quad Winch?

To ensure the longevity and optimal performance of your quad winch, several maintenance practices should be undertaken regularly.

  • Regular Cleaning: Keeping the winch clean is essential to prevent dirt and debris from accumulating, which can lead to corrosion and mechanical failure. Use a soft brush and mild soap to remove grime, and be sure to rinse thoroughly and dry to avoid moisture retention.
  • Lubrication: Proper lubrication of moving parts is crucial in reducing friction and wear. Apply appropriate lubricant on gears, bearings, and cables as recommended by the manufacturer to maintain smooth operation and prevent rust.
  • Inspecting Cables and Hooks: Regularly check the winch cable for fraying, kinks, or signs of wear, as these can compromise strength and safety. Additionally, inspect the hook for any deformities or wear and replace them as needed to ensure reliable performance.
  • Electrical System Checks: Ensure that the electrical connections and wiring are intact and free from corrosion. Regularly test the winch’s remote control and battery to confirm that they are functioning correctly, as electrical issues can lead to operational failures.
  • Winch Mount Integrity: Inspect the winch mounting system for tightness and stability, as a loose mount can lead to misalignment and increased wear. Ensure that all bolts and fittings are secure to maintain the winch’s operational security and effectiveness.
  • Storage Practices: When not in use, store the winch in a dry and protected location to shield it from the elements. Use a winch cover to provide additional protection against dust, moisture, and UV rays, which can degrade materials over time.
